by bosleynguyen » Wed, 01 Feb 2012 11:30 am
UPDATE
It may help someone else when they later do it.
I came to MOM this morning by making an appointment yesterday. Got the queue as normal and a nice lady attended to me. She advised me to call my HR to cancel my EP and she will proceed the issuance of PEP on the spot as Singapore goverment already implemented the biometric online data card so that one person is allowed to hold one card at a time. I am now waiting to collect the card and still allowed to work without any rest and money leaking.

The information shown is very clear. It means that you are already on an EP/DP issued to you by the MOM which is attached to your employer.
Once your employer login into EPOL (MOM System to apply/issue/cancel EP) and then cancels your
current EP/DP, then you will be able to issue your PEP.
all EP passes through many stages like Approved (By MOM) - > Issued (By your employer to you or by yourself to you in the case of PEP)
